> (It is lamentable that the manuals for all Tentec rigs are not on a 
> website
> to make reference to.)  There are two 8-pin (DIN-type) jacks on the rear 
> of
> the rigs.  1) is for linking to a tuner and gives out the band that the 
> rig
> is set to.  2) is both an audio input and output, and keying control for
> amp-to-rig.  The psk-type linking is done through this jack. There is 
> recvr
> muting on one pin, etc.
>
> If anyone needs the exact tect I'll be happy to type out the pin
> descriptions from page 2-10 of the 535/536 manual.
